Using a wearable fitness tracker to monitor your exercise is one thing. Yet the real value comes when biometric sensor data in the tracker can connect to a post-surgical recovery plan, communicate healing progress back to the surgeon in real time, show how the patient’s progress compares to other (anonymous) patients’, suggest more effective ways to expedite healing and mobility and avoid increases in long-term medical insurance premiums. Here, the connection between data, things, and the Internet can transform the experience—, both immediate and long term.
The Internet of Things refers to the networking of physical objects through the use of embedded sensors, actuators, and other devices that can collect or transmit information about the objects. The data amassed from these devices can then be analyzed to optimize products, services, and operations. Perhaps one of the earliest and best-known applications of such technology has been in the area of energy optimization: sensors deployed across the electricity grid can help utilities remotely monitor energy usage and adjust generation and distribution flows to account for peak times and downtimes. But applications are also being introduced in a number of other industries. Some insurance companies, for example, now offer plans that require drivers to install a sensor in their cars, allowing insurers to base premiums on actual driving behavior rather than projections. And physicians can use the information collected from wireless sensors in their patients’ homes to improve their management of chronic diseases. Through continuous monitoring rather than periodic testing, physicians could reduce their treatment costs by between 10 and 20 percent, according to McKinsey Global Institute research—billions of dollars could be saved in the care of congestive heart failure alone.

Beacons are low-cost, low-powered transmitters equipped with Bluetooth Low Energy or BLE
(also called Bluetooth 4.0 or Bluetooth Smart) that can be used to deliver proximity-based,
context-aware messages.They are ideal for detecting smartphones indoors, where GPS isn’t
always effective, and sending alerts and data to apps on those devices. Also while GPS operates
at a macro range, beacons work at micro range, giving brands an opportunity to interact with
customers not only at a store level but also target narrowly at an aisle or a fixture level. In terms
of range, beacons function in the interim of NFC (too narrow) and GPS (too broad) ranges, and
that is what makes it more effective than the other two.
Beacons rely on the two-way communication (that the BLE technology allows) between an app
and a strategically placed beacon. The technology gives brands and businesses an opportunity
to build innovative proximity-aware apps for any Bluetooth Low Energy-capable mobile device.

1. Lift and Shift
The Lift and Shift cloud migration technique includes migrating an existing application to a modern cloud platform as is, with very little modification to the architecture of the application. Because the architecture of the existing application was likely architected for its original host, the application might fail to take advantage of the features and benefits of the new cloud platform.
